Summary
Predicted to be a structural constituent of ribosome. Predicted to be involved in maturation of SSU-rRNA from tricistronic rRNA transcript (SSU-rRNA, 5.8S rRNA, LSU-rRNA). Predicted to be located in cytosolic ribosome and endoplasmic reticulum. Predicted to be part of cytosolic small ribosomal subunit. Is expressed in brain. Orthologous to human RPS8 (ribosomal protein S8). [provided by Alliance of Genome Resources, Apr 2022]
